PSLE Howard and Liam were paid a total of $3420 for a job they did. Liam was paid $1400 less than Howard.
- How much was Liam paid for the job?
- Howard and Liam were paid based on the number of days they worked. Howard worked 2 times as many days as Liam. Howard was paid $15 more than Liam per day. How many days did Howard work?
(a)
Amount that Liam was paid = 1 u
Amount that Howard was paid = 1 u + 1400
Total amount paid
= 1 u + 1 u + 1400
= 2 u + 1400
2 u + 1400 = 3420
2 u = 3420 - 1400
2 u = 2020
1 u = 2020 ÷ 2 = 1010
Amount that Liam was paid
= 1 u
= $1010
(b)
Amount that Howard was paid
= 1 u + 1400
= 1010 + 1400
= $2410
Howard worked 2 times as many days as Liam.
2 sets of Howard's salary = $2410
1 set of Howard's salary
= 2410 ÷ 2
= $1205
1 set of Liam's salary = $1010
Difference between each set of Howard's and Liam's salaries
= 1205 - 1010
= $195
Number of days in 1 set
= 195 ÷ 15
= 13
Number of days that Howard worked
= 2 x 13
= 26
Answer(s): (a) $1010; (b) 26
